Distinguish between:
Saturated hydrocarbons - Unsaturated hydrocarbons
Advertisements
Solution
| Saturated hydrocarbons | Unsaturated hydrocarbons | |
| 1. | Hydrocarbons having the carbon atoms linked to each other by single bonds are called saturated hydrocarbons. | Hydrocarbons having at least one carbon-carbon double or triple bond are called unsaturated hydrocarbons. |
| 2. | On burning, saturated hydrocarbons give a clean, blue flame. | On burning, unsaturated hydrocarbons give a yellow flame with lots of black smoke. |
| 3. | Saturated hydrocarbons do not decolourize bromine or iodine solutions. | Unsaturated hydrocarbons decolourize bromine or iodine solutions. |
| 4. | Saturated hydrocarbons are less reactive. | Unsaturated hydrocarbons are usually highly reactive. |
